Two Men Tied Up, Assaulted During Home Invasion Robbery in Mar Vista

Police did not have a description of the suspects.

Two men were tied up and and one of them were assaulted early Wednesday morning during a home invasion robbery in the Mar Vista area, police said.

The robbery was reported around 2:30 a.m. in the 3500 block of Centinnela Avenue, according to the Los Angeles Police Department.

Three masked men armed with a crow bar and sledgehammer forced their way into the home. The men then tied duct tape on the victims, according to the LAPD.

One of the men was struck in the face, which caused bruising and a bloody nose, police said.

Police said the robbers stole an Acura TSX from the residence. It was unclear what else was taken during the robbery.

The victims were able to free themselves from the duct tape and alert a neighbor who called 911, police said.

Police were investigating whether the robbers targeted the two victims.
